I have used copper for 15 years on this boat. A great reception from
east coast USA all the way to Spain , Maderia back to Guyana and all of
the Caribbean. But the copper finally disintegrated, so I'm looking for
a better way for preserving it.

Grounding plane for SSB.

Hanz



Hanz, you don't need to use expensive copper foil that's just going to get
eaten, anyways. Aluminum flyscreen or even galvanized chicken wire works
just as good at 1% of the cost. Just unroll the chicken wire up out of the
bilge water along the hull under the waterline and it forms a big capacitor
with the seawater outside. Fold it up where the ground cable is connected
to it for better conductivity so it can fan out the current.....

Don't be too neat! No folds to neatly get it around a corner. RF doesn't
flow around corners.
